Question: An electric field of magnitude 3.49 kN/C is applied along the x axis.

Part I: Calculate the electric flux through a rectangular plane 0.350 m wide and 0.700 m long in the following cases.

A: the plane is parallel to the yz plane

_________________N • m2/C

B: the plane is parallel to the xy plane

___________________ N • m2/C

C: the plane contains the y axis and its normal makes an angle of 37.8° with the xaxis

__________________N • m2/C
